EA Warns Of Known Issues In College Football 25 Following Launch

College Football 25, EA Sport's first college football title in more than a decade, is off to a great start with some impressive player numbers. It's not all smooth sailing for the new game, however, with a number of known issues the team is working hard to patch up post-launch. Here are all the bugs to look out for ahead of upcoming patches--note that a July 23 patch may have corrected some of these issues, as well.

Firstly, EA has reiterated that some inaccuracies with rosters and likenesses are to be expected at this point, and that it is working to fix them up. The developer even warned of this prior to launch, due to the huge number of players and schools in the game.

As an additional complication, the game is launching at the same time as the "summer roster movement that is natural to college football," EA says in its update. "For our very passionate Dynasty fans, you can hop in and play this week or wait for a roster update around college football kickoff for the most up to date experience."
